#186149 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#186149 is composed of 9.4% red, 38%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.7%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 160.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.3% and a lightness of 23.7%. #186149 color hex could be obtained by blending #30c292 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

● #186149 color description : Very dark c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#186149 has RGB values of R:24, G:97,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 1597769.
